Based on the available information, the North Boulder Lake Campground Boat Launch is located at latitude 42.84073895000006 and longitude -109.70217392499995 in Wyoming. It is a boat ramp that provides access to North Boulder Lake, a small lake located in the Bridger-Teton National Forest in western Wyoming.
According to the official website of the Bridger-Teton National Forest, the boat ramp at North Boulder Lake Campground is a single-lane ramp that is wide enough to accommodate small boats and trailers. The website also states that only non-motorized watercraft are allowed on the lake, which includes kayaks, canoes, and paddleboards.
Therefore, it can be concluded that the North Boulder Lake Campground Boat Launch is a small boat ramp that services a non-motorized lake and is suitable for small boats and trailers.
